Microstructural and optical properties of Ba0.5Sr0.5TiO3 thin film deposited by pulsed laser deposition for low loss waveguide applications

Abstract
Barium strontium titanate (Ba0.5Sr0.5TiO3 or BST) films were grown on SiO2∕Si substrate by means of a reactive pulsed laser deposition technique. The microstructural and surface morphology of BST films were characterized by x-ray diffraction, scanning electron microscopy, and atomic force microscopy. Films deposited at 400°C were found to be amorphous and present wide cracks. The crystallization of the films was induced by annealing at 600°C. The BST films deposited at 550°C present a cubic perovskite structure with a dense and smooth surface. The optical constants (n and k as a function of wavelength) of the films were obtained using variable angle spectroscopic ellipsometry in the UV-vis-NIR regions. Microfabricated BST∕SiO2∕Si ridged waveguides were patterned using UV photolithography and high-density plasma etching. The propagation and loss characteristics at the telecommunication wavelength of 1.55μm were investigated using top-view scattering and Fabry-Pérot resonance methods. For specific ridge widths, we obtained single-mode propagation with relatively low losses (∼1dB∕cm), thereby demonstrating the strong potential of BST films for guided-wave components for advanced optical integrated systems.
